Spring boot path variable with slashes
Web2 Feb 2024 · Let's first create a java.net.URL object by using its constructor and passing in a String representing the human readable address of the resource: URL url = new URL ( "/a-guide-to-java-sockets" ); We've just created an absolute URL object. The address has all the parts required to reach the desired resource. Web21 Oct 2024 · In Spring Boot 1.5.4 I have a request mapping like this: @RequestMapping (value = "/graph/ {graphId}/details/ {iri:.+}", method = RequestMethod.GET, produces = …
Spring boot path variable with slashes
Did you know?
Web2 Jan 2013 · I'm trying to use a URI-encoded value as a path segment value when constructing a link with LinkBuilder's slash() method, but I find that any 'special' characters (such as %) will be repeatedly double-encoded by each subsequent slash() call. For example: Web@RequestMapping (value= {"/vault/key", "/vault/key/key1", "/vault/key/key1"}, method = RequestMethod.GET) public ResponseEntity getEntity ( @RequestHeader HttpHeaders headers, @RequestHeader (name = "X-Vault-Token") String token, HttpServletRequest request, @PathVariable (name = "key") String key) { log.info (String.format ("%s provided …
Web10 Apr 2024 · 2. Spring MVC and Webflux URL Matching Changes. Spring Boot 3 significantly changed the trailing slash matching configuration option. This option determines whether or not to treat a URL with a trailing slash the same as a URL without one. Previous versions of Spring Boot set this option to true by default. This meant that a … Web10 Apr 2024 · 2. Spring MVC and Webflux URL Matching Changes. Spring Boot 3 significantly changed the trailing slash matching configuration option. This option …
Web19 Nov 2013 · 1.While resolving the path to a request mapper we do not want URL to be decoded (No Decode) 2.However while the path variable is injected into the method, we … WebA @Path value isn’t required to have leading or trailing slashes (/). The JAX-RS runtime parses URI path templates the same whether or not they have leading or trailing spaces. A URI path template has one or more variables, with each variable name surrounded by braces: {to begin the variable name and } to end it.
WebTo obtain the value of the username variable, the @PathParamannotation may be used on the method parameter of a request method, as shown in the following code example. @Path("/users/{username}") public class UserResource { @GET @Produces("text/xml") public String getUser(@PathParam("username") String userName) { ...
WebI tried using @PathVariable Map path and also @RequestMapping (value = "/ {eid}/ {urlParts:.+}" but couldn't get the expected result. Is there any solution to receive … city college undergraduate majorsWeb9 Dec 2024 · The slash character is the URI standard path delimiter, and all that goes after it counts as a new level in the path hierarchy. As expected, Spring follows this standard. We … city college university footballWeb23 Nov 2024 · Step 1: Go to Spring Initializr Step 2: Fill in the details as per the requirements. For this application: Project: Maven Language: Java Spring Boot: 2.2.8 Packaging: JAR … dictionary drossWebSpring Boot 2 - request mapping with wildcard parameter (/path/**) Spring Boot 2 - enable encoded backslash support in path segments (\ encoding as %5C, e.g. … city college uniformhttp://duoduokou.com/json/27269460562024795084.html dictionary dubWeb31 May 2024 · On the other hand, path variables exist inside the resource path and are used for locating a specific resource or document. For example, the URI tickets/23/ has a path variable with the value 23. We will talk more in depth about path variables in a later tutorial. For now, I hope you enjoyed this tutorial and thanks for reading!. city college undergraduate bulletinWeb1 Jun 2016 · To answer the original question: I don't see a need to add URL parameters to the URL map. They would only add value if we added them as method arguments, but I think that would be very confusing as path variables are passed as arguments at the moment. You can use the %request.Data property to retrieve the URL parameters. dictionary dubiously